7. This affidavit is based on an investigation by the FBI into the activities of

A. BUNDY, RITZHEIMER, O'SHAUGHNESSY, PAYNE, R. BUNDY, CAVALIER, Finicum,

COX, SANTILLI, and others in connection with an armed occupation of the Malheur National

Wildlife Refuge (MNWR), a unit of the National Wildlife Refuge System managed by the

United States Fish and Wildlife Service (USFWS). The MNWR is federal property.


Hammond Sentencing


8. On June 6, 2012, Dwight and Steven Hammond were convicted of two counts of

arson by a jury in the District of Oregon. They were originally sentenced on October 30, 2012.

Dwight Hammond was sentenced to serve three months in prison, and Steven Hammond was

sentenced to serve twelve months. On February 7, 2014, the Ninth Circuit Court of Appeals


Affidavit of Katherine Armstrong Page3


Case 3:16-mj-00004 Document 1 Filed 01/26/16 Page 5 of 32


overturned the District Court's sentence. The United States Supreme Court denied a petition for

writ of certiorari on March 23, 2015. On October 7, 2015, Dwight and Steven Hammond were

resentenced to serve a mandatory, five-year term of imprisonment. On January 4, 2016, the

Hammonds reported to a Federal Correctional Institute in California to serve the remainder of

their sentences. Prior to surrendering to serve their sentences, the Hammonds, through their

attorney, continued to distance themselves from A. BUNDY and his group.


9. On January 4, 2016, A. BUNDY addressed the media and stated that he named

his group of protesters the "Citizens for Constitutional Freedom" (CCF), and they were acting in

support of the Hammonds. A. BUNDY told a national morning news show that members of

CCF were armed because "We are serious about being here. We're serious about defending our

rights, and we are serious about getting some things straightened out." When asked on the show

ifhe anticipated it would lead to violence, A. BUNDY responded, "Only ifthe government

wants to take it there."


10. In a video posted on an Internet website titled "Citizens for Constitutional

Freedom News Conference" posted on January 4, 2016, A. BUNDY said their purpose is to

restore and defend the Constitution, and they have spent two months petitioning the state and

county representatives to stand for the Hammonds against the so-called "unconstitutional

actions." Bundy said, "We feel that we have exhausted all prudent measures and have been

ignored. And it has been left to us to decide whether we allow these things to go on or whether

we make a stand." In the video, Finicum makes a statement about the purported oppression

against ranchers, specifically the Hammonds.


11. On January 4, 2016, Hamey County Sheriff Dave Ward held a press conference

and informed the armed occupiers of the MNWR that the Hammonds had peacefully surrendered


Affidavit of Katherine Armstrong Page4


Case 3:16-mj-00004 Document 1 Filed 01/26/16 Page 6 of 32


themselves to complete their federal sentences and informed the armed occupiers that "it was

time to leave."


Armed Occupier Activity in Harney County, Oregon


12. On October 5, 2015, A. BUNDY and PAYNE visited Hamey County Sheriff

Dave Ward in Hamey County. During the visit, A. BUNDY and PAYNE told Ward that he

needed to protect the Hammonds from going back to prison. PAYNE and A. BUNDY informed

Ward that if the Hammonds spent one more day in jail there would be "extreme civil unrest."

On November 12, 2015, A. BUNDY publicly posted a letter from the Bundy family to Hamey

County Sheriff Dave Ward. The letter was posted online at http://bundyranch.blogspot.com and

was still publicly viewable as of January 26, 2016. In summary, the Bundy family claims that

federal employees are abusing their positions within the federal government to punish the

Hammond family. Several additional blog posts, made on November 12 and later, further state

that it is the Bundy family position that the Hammond family has been illegally arrested.

13. A Facebook Community page titled "Hamey County Liberty News" includes

eight videos on the page. I personally viewed the Facebook page on January 7, 2016, and all

videos appear to be narrated by the same individual, who identifies himself on several of the

videos. In one of the videos, posted on December 12, 2015, and titled "Time for some camping"

the individual is pictured standing outside with the road sign "Hammond Ranch Rd" clearly

visible in the background. The individual talks about winter camping and camping in the area.

In a video posted on December 13, 2015, and titled "Through the wind and snow yesterday I

neglected to post this lovely cattle drive," the individual identifies himself as being present in

Harney County and later states he is doing some "tactical camping." In an untitled video posted

December 15, 2015, he discusses a community meeting in Hamey County and shows a flyer for


Affidavit of Katherine Armstrong Pages


Case 3:16-mj-00004 Document 1 Filed 01/26/16 Page 7 of 32


the meeting indicating that it will include a "presentation on Committee of Safety by Ryan

Payne."


14. On December 18, 2015, a citizen (hereafter Citizen) of Hamey County was

shopping at the Safeway grocery store in Bums, Oregon. Citizen was wearing a BLM shirt.

Citizen was confronted by two men, one whom she identified as RITZHEIMER. Citizen

reported to law enforcement that she heard yelling, and when she turned around, the second

individual shouted "you're BLM, you're BLM" at her. That person further stated to Citizen that

they know what car she drives and would follow her home. He also stated he was going to bum

Citizen's house down. RITZHEIMER and the second individual left the area in a black pick-up

truck with black canopy and no visible license plate. Since the incident, Citizen has observed a

similar vehicle outside her residence. Citizen was unable to identify the driver of the vehicle

when she later saw it. The following week, a second vehicle, described as a white truck with a

pink license plate and a big rebel flag sticker on the back window, aggressively tailgated Citizen,

flashing lights and driving erratically. Citizen believed the second incident was related to the

first. Citizen also saw the black pick-up truck outside of her place of employment early in the

morning hours of Christmas Day.


15. On December 26, 2015, a video posted to an Internet website channel indicated

the video is a "call out" to all "patriots" to meet at the Safeway parking lot in Bums, Oregon, on

January 2, 2016, for the protest. One of the individuals states they are in Bums, Oregon, and are

there to support the Hammonds. A screenshot from the video, attached below, shows

O'SHAUGHNESSY on the far left and RITZHEIMER on the far right. In the video each

individual identifies himself by name. Their identities have also been independently confirmed

through motor vehicle records.


Affidavit of Katherine Armstrong Page 6


Case 3:16-mj-00004 Document 1 Filed 01/26/16 Page 8 of 32


16. On December 31, 2015, a video posted to an Internet website showed

RITZHEIMER in a car saying "we the people need to take a stand," "we need real men and

women here to take a stand" and that he has "had to do a lot of soul searching" and he is "one

hundred percent willing to lay down my life, to fight against tyranny in this country."

January 2016 - Takeover of Malheur National Wildlife Refuge


17. According to open source reporting that I have reviewed and conversations I have

had with other law enforcement officers, on January 2, 2016, several hundred unidentified

individuals participated in a protest in Bums, Oregon, related to the resentencing of Steven and

Dwight Hammond. Following the protest, A. BUNDY, RITZHEIMER, O'SHAUGHNESSY,

PAYNE, R. BUNDY, CAVALIER, and Finicum, among others, entered the MNWR, blocked

the entrance to the Refuge, and began their armed occupation of several buildings within the

MNWR. The MNWR and all buildings located thereon are federal property and facilities. The

armed occupation of the MNWR has been continuous and ongoing since Janμary 2, 2016. The


Affidavit of Katherine Armstrong Page 7


Case 3:16-mj-00004 Document 1 Filed 01/26/16 Page 9 of 32


MNWR is located in Hamey County, District of Oregon. A news article posted on an Internet

website on January 3, 2016, at 7:19 a.m. and updated January 4, 2016, at 12:53 p.m. included a

photo with the caption "The militiamen have blocked the entrance to the headquarters of the

Malheur National Wildlife Refuge with vehicles" and is shown below. This photograph has

been verified by a Federal Wildlife Officer with the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service and

confirmed to depict the entrance to the MNWR. The Federal Wildlife Officer identified the

vehicle as an MNWR vehicle blocking the main road.


18. According to a senior official with the U.S . Fish and Wildlife Service, Pacific

Region, the MNWR is adjacent to the Steens Mountain Wilderness, with the Wild and Scenic

Donner and Blitzen River flowing into it at its southern boundary. The MNWR consists of more

than 187,700 acres of prime habitat, including 120,000 acres of wetlands that provide a crucial

stop for waterfowl along the Pacific Flyway. Particularly important to colonial waterbirds,

sandhill cranes, and redband trout, the Refuge also encompasses upland and riparian habitats

vital to many migrating birds and wildlife. The MNWR hosts over 320 bird species and 58


Affidavit of Katherine Armstrong Pages


Case 3:16-mj-00004 Document 1 Filed 01/26/16 Page 10 of 32


mammal species. The MNWR supports over 20 percent of the Oregon population of breeding

greater sandhill cranes. Refuge property includes more than 200 miles of water delivery ditches,

7 major irrigation dams, 450 miles offence, and 200 miles of roads.


19. Refuge property also contains 13 historic buildings. Many were built by the

Civilian Conservation Corps in the 1930s and early 1940s. The headquarters features National

Register of Historic Places structures and landscaping including five wood frame buildings (clad

with local lava rock and roofed with terra cotta tile) that function as offices, workshops, natural

resource labs, and visitor facilities. A historic lookout tower, mature landscaping, and modem

shop, garage, and wetland management infrastructure are also part of the historical headquarters

ensemble. In 2014, there were 23,967 visitors to the MNWR including birders, hunters and

outdoor recreationists. The winter hunting season closed at the end of December; currently,

there are no open hunting seasons on the Refuge.


20. The MNWR is staffed by employees of the United States Fish and Wildlife

Service. As a result of the armed occupation of the MNWR by the known conspirators and

others, which began on or about January 2, 2016, and continuing to the present, employees of the

USFWS who work at the MNWR have been prevented from reporting to work because of threats

of violence posed by the defendants and others occupying the property. Sixteen (16) federal

employees work at the MNWR, including one federal law enforcement officer and a volunteer

coordinator who lived on the Refuge and works in the visitor center.


21. According to a senior official with the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service, Pacific

Region, following the unauthorized, armed occupation of the MNWR, the staff has been unable

to conduct any official operations, including but not limited to business elements, critical

management requirements, law enforcement operations, visitor services, and essential


Affidavit of Katherine Armstrong Page9


Case 3:16-mj-00004 Document 1 Filed 01/26/16 Page 11 of 32


maintenance activities. As a result, the MNWR is being degraded and damaged by the inability

of the staff to conduct required conservation management operations which are essential to the

MNWR. The staff is entrusted with the management of the MNWR through the Fish and

Wildlife Service Mission, the Refuge System Mission, and the governing comprehensive

conservation planning document which includes the applicable authorities of the Refuge

Administration Act, the Refuge Improvement Act, as well as supporting acts. In addition, active

contracts, cooperative agreements, and other partnership arrangements requiring work on the part

of contractors or collaborative partners are not able to occur as a result of the armed

occupation. Any and all legal arrangements that exist with contractors and other business

collaborators are being hindered resulting in loss of time, funding, and critical management

elements.


22. USFWS management believes that as long as this unauthorized, armed occupation

persists, it is unsafe for employees to be in the area.

The statute they are charged under:

"If two or more persons in any State, Territory, Possession, or District conspire to prevent, by force, intimidation, or threat, any person from accepting or holding any office, trust, or place of confidence under the United States, or from discharging any duties thereof, or to induce by like means any officer of the United States to leave the place, where his duties as an officer are required to be performed, or to injure him in his person or property on account of his lawful discharge of the duties of his office, or while engaged in the lawful discharge thereof, or to injure his property so as to molest, interrupt, hinder, or impede him in the discharge of his official duties, each of such persons shall be fined under this title or imprisoned not more than six years, or both."
